| Industry | Application | Process |
|---|---|---|
| Chemical Synthesis | Organic synthesis intermediate | Serves as a precursor in the synthesis of liquid crystal materials, surfactants, and polymeric compounds |
| Materials Science | Monomer raw material for liquid crystals | Acts as a mesogenic unit in the synthesis of thermotropic or lyotropic liquid crystals |
| Polymer Industry | Phenolic resin modifier | Introduces long alkyl chains to enhance resin flexibility and hydrophobicity |
| Surfactant Manufacturing | Component of nonionic surfactants | Processed via ethoxylation and similar reactions to produce surfactants with emulsifying or wetting functionality |
| Detection Item | Common Analytical Method | Method Overview |
|---|---|---|
| Assay (Purity) | Gas Chromatography (GC) with FID detection | Quantifies 4-pentylphenol peak area relative to calibration standards using retention time and response factor. |
| Water Content | Karl Fischer Titration | Measures water via stoichiometric reaction between water, iodine, sulfur dioxide, and base in methanol medium. |
| Acidity (as p-toluenesulfonic acid) | Acid-Base Titration with NaOH | Neutralizes acidic impurities using standardized sodium hydroxide solution and phenolphthalein indicator. |
| Residue on Ignition | Gravimetric Analysis | Determines non-volatile inorganic residue after high-temperature ashing and weighing. |
| Heavy Metals (as Pb) | Atomic Absorption Spectroscopy (AAS) | Quantifies total heavy metals by atomization and absorption of characteristic wavelength light. |
| Chlorinated Impurities |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C-MS) | Identifies and quantifies chlorinated by-products based on retention time and mass spectral fragmentation patterns. |
| Color (APHA) | Visual Comparison or Spectrophotometry | Compares sample color intensity against platinum-cobalt standard solutions at 455 nm. |
| Melting Point | Capillary Melting Point Apparatus | Determines temperature range at which solid transitions to liquid using calibrated capillary tube method. |
| Specific Gravity | Digital Density Meter | Measures density relative to water at specified temperature using oscillating U-tube principle. |
| Refractive Index | Refractometer | Determines ratio of light velocity in air versus sample at 20 degrees C using critical angle measurement. |
| Non-Volatile Residue | Evaporation and Gravimetry | Weighs residue remaining after controlled evaporation of a known sample mass under nitrogen. |
| Odor | Sensory Evaluation | Assesses presence and intensity of off-odor by trained personnel under controlled conditions. |
